That's exactly what I was trying to say...I close them out under a buck to release the margin capacity held against the open positions...if you had a lot of open positions and bought them to close, you could free up a good chunk of margin capacity, reset new positions, buy something, or just do nothing until the spirit or market moves you.

Freeing it up for something else.
